Grace A. Dow Memorial Library The Polio Crusade: an American Experience film will be screened Thur, Oct 29, 7pm, Library Auditorium. Following the film, David Carpenter, Rotary Zone 29 Polio Challenge Coordinator, will tell us about the current situation with the eradication of polio, the dangers that face those who administer the vaccine and the role of various organizaions in this fight.
